Controversial Call Eliminates Team from Playoffs

We had a little controversy in District 11-5A Division 1 which has one team out of playoff contention.

The Leander Glenn Grizzlies came into their battle with the Georgetown Eagles at 5-3. A win would put them 4th in district play and highly likely to make the playoffs. A loss would eliminate them from playoff contention. For most of the game, it appeared that the Grizzlies would get the much-needed win.

Glenn controlled most of the first half of the game, all be it close. They had a 17-7 lead late into the first half. But, the Eagles found the end-zone on a long 50-yard touchdown from Noah Booras to Marquis Dominguez to cut the Glenn lead to 17-14.

Then, just 2 minutes into the third-quarter, Booras hit Andrew Petter for a 45-yard touchdown and a 21-17 lead. Then, with just over 3 minutes to go in the third, Dominguez caught his third touchdown of the game to make it 28-17.

The Grizzlies were able to put together a scoring drive early in the fourth, getting a field goal to cut the lead to 28-20. Then, things got wild.

Georgetown blocked a Glenn punt, but Glenn recovered it. Glenn kept possession and moved the ball down the field. With just over 1 minute to go, Glenn had the ball first and goal.

On third down, they had the ball inside of 1 minute and inside the 1-yard line looking for a tying touchdown and go-ahead extra point. QB Sky Mendez ran for what seemed like the tying touchdown. The Grizzlies fans celebrated. Most of the Eagles fans assumed it was a touchdown. But, after a very long delay, Mendez was ruled short. 

Glen got two more chances to score from inside the 1-yard line, with an Eagles penalty giving them third and goal again. But, Georgetown stopped Glenn on twice more from inside the 1, and the ball was turned over on downs. The Eagles took a safety on the final play to end the game 28-22.

Georgetown improved to 5-1 in the district and 7-2 overall. They face Cedar Park next week, and Cedar Park has now replaced Glenn for 4th in the district at 4-2 in district play, though 4-5 overall. Glenn falls to 3-3 in district play and 5-4 overall. They finish their season at College Station A&M Consolidated Tigers. The Tigers are tied with Georgetown at 5-1 in the district and 7-2 overall.
